District 14 of the Texas Senate is a senatorial district that currently serves Bastrop County and a portion of Travis county in the U.S. state of Texas .
The seat for District 14 is currently vacant.

District 14 has a population of 834,750 with 640,349 that is at voting age from the 2010 census .[1]

Upcoming election
The seat for District 14 became vacant on April 30, 2020, after the resignation of Kirk Watson .[3] A special election has been called for July 14, 2020.
